<blockquote data-quote="upnorth" data-source="post: 1001675" data-attributes="member: 38832"><p>The problem with password protected settings is that with a local administration account, it's dead easy to boot in SafeMode edit a little reg entry from 1 to 0, reboot the machine and it's Game Over. I know that's the case with at least 1 of those extra mentioned AVs in this thread. That's one reason why I prefer SUA ( standard user account ).</p></blockquote><p></p>
